Who pays us, and who does not
We list three US sellers. Two of them have an affiliate agreement with us. One does not.
- Giftcards.com — affiliate agreement, through Rakuten Advertising.
- eGifter — affiliate agreement, through AWIN.
- CardCash — no affiliate agreement. We earn nothing when you buy from them, and they are listed, ranked and shown exactly like the other two.
That last line is the one worth checking us on. A comparison site that only lists the sellers who pay it is an advertisement wearing a comparison’s clothes.
How it works
When you click Buy now on a seller we have an agreement with, the link passes through that seller’s advertising network. The network sets a cookie so that if you buy something, the sale is credited to us and the seller pays us a small share of it.
The commission comes out of the seller’s margin, not your total. You pay the same price you would pay going to them directly. There is no Felix Day markup, because there is no mechanism for one — we never handle the transaction.
Where there is no agreement, the link goes straight to the seller, unwrapped, and nobody pays us anything.
What money is not allowed to change
Paying us does not move a seller up a comparison. Offers are ordered by what the card actually costs you. A seller that pays us nothing can and does appear above one that pays.
We also never mix new cards and resold cards into one ranked list, whoever is paying. They come with different terms, and a lower price attached to different terms is only a better deal if you can see the difference.
This is a constraint we have chosen and it costs us money. If comparison order were for sale, this site would be worth nothing to you, and we would rather it did not exist than exist like that.
One referral link, separately
Our announcement about the CardCash partnership contains a referral link that gives you $5 off a first order and credits us if you use it. It is labelled as one on that page. It is not an affiliate agreement and it does not affect how CardCash is ranked anywhere on this site.
How to check any of this
Open any product page. The disclosure sits under the offers, on every page, whether or not the sellers shown on it pay us. Follow a Buy now link and watch where it goes — you will land on the seller’s own domain before you are asked for anything.
